Tie Rod Assemblies
A critical part of your steering system which enables the wheels to turn by transmitting power.


MOOG® tie rod assemblies Easy-to-fit direct replacement parts
Key Product Features
The tie rod assembly transmits power from your steering center link or the rack gear to your steering knuckle. The outer tie rod end connects with an adjusting sleeve, which allows the length of the tie rod to be adjusted to set the vehicle’s critical alignment angle, making it an essential part in your steering system. The assemblies contain all the parts you need, including outer tie rod end and axial rod.
TIP: Check your tie rod assembly at least once a year to maintain the integrity of the steering system and avoid excessive or uneven tyre wear.
